On , OSHA opened an unprogrammed Related safety inspection of BUILDING SPECIALISTS in 8653 E. HWY 67, ALVARADO, TX 76009 (NAICS 238120). OSHA activity number 310442389.

What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970:  The
employer did not
fur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from
recognized hazards that
were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to
employees in that employees
were exposed to:
Falls of up to 26 feet to the ground below from the basket of the forklift.
a.On or about 9/28/07 at the job site:  Employees were potentially exposed
to falls of up
to 26 feet to the ground below from the work platform, attached to the Sky
Trak 6036 forklift,
which was wider than the overall width of the truck plus 10 inches on
either side.
b.On or about 10/3/07 at the job site:  Employees were potentially exposed
to falls of up
to 26 feet to the ground below from the work platform, attached to the
XTreme 56238 forklift,
which was wider than the overall width of the truck plus 10 inches on
either side.
Among other methods, one feasible and acceptable means to abate this
hazard is to use a work
platform that is designed in accordance with American Society of
Mechanical Engineers
ANSI/ASME B56.6-6-2002, Safety Standards for Rough Terrain Forklift Trucks.
Pursuant to 29 CFR 1903.19, the employer must submit an abatement plan
within 25 days
describing the actions it is taking to ensure compliance, including a
description of how these
steps protect its employees from falls from this work platform.
